Chinaunix首页 | 论坛 | 博客
  • 博客访问: 84091
  • 博文数量: 12
  • 博客积分: 126
  • 博客等级: 入伍新兵
  • 技术积分: 190
  • 用 户 组: 普通用户
  • 注册时间: 2011-05-13 22:53
文章分类

全部博文(12)

文章存档

2015年(1)

2014年(2)

2013年(4)

2012年(2)

2011年(3)

我的朋友

分类: Oracle

2013-06-15 21:14:54

1.设定SID
ORACLE_SID=logdb
export ORACLE_SID


2. 设定其它环境变量
ORALCE_HOME,PATH等。


创建相关目录:
mkdir -p /u01/app/oracle/admin/logdb/adump 
mkdir -p /u01/app/oracle/admin/logdb/bdump
mkdir -p /u01/app/oracle/admin/logdb/cdump
mkdir -p /u01/app/oracle/admin/logdb/udump


 3.选择数据库管理员的授权方式
选择密码文件方式。
orapwd file=$ORACLE_HOME/dbs/orapwlogdb password=admin entries=5 force=y
file参数必须说明全路径。


Table 1-1 Required Password File Name and Location on UNIX, Linux, and Windows
Platform Required Name    Required Location)
UNIX and Linux orapwORACLE_SID    ORACLE_HOME/dbs
Windows        PWDORACLE_SID.ora   ORACLE_HOME\database


4.创建初始化参数文件


Platform  Default Name                              Default Location
UNIX and Linux  initORACLE_SID.ora                          ORACLE_HOME/dbs
                  For example, the initialization parameter 
                  file for the mynewdb database is named:
                  initmynewdb.ora
Windows          initORACLE_SID.ora                      ORACLE_HOME\database


# Change '' to point to the oracle base (the one you specify at
# install time)


db_name='logdb'    #不要超过8个字符
memory_target=8G
processes = 500
audit_file_dest='/u01/app/oracle/admin/logdb/adump'
audit_trail ='db'
db_block_size=32768
db_domain=''
service_name='logdbsvc'
instance_name='logdb'
local_listener='logdb_listener'   #在tnsname.ora中该定义连接串
#db_recovery_file_dest='/flash_recovery_area'
#db_recovery_file_dest_size=2G
diagnostic_dest='/u01/app/oracle'
dispatchers='(PROTOCOL=TCP) (SERVICE=ORCLXDB)'
open_cursors=300 
remote_login_passwordfile='EXCLUSIVE'
undo_tablespace='UNDOTBS1'
# You may want to ensure that control files are created on separate physical
# devices
control_files = ('+CRS/logdb/controlfile/ora_control1','+CRS/logdb/controlfile/ora_control2')
compatible ='11.2.0'
log_archive_dest_1='LOCATION=+CRS'
background_dump_dest=/u01/app/oracle/admin/logdb/bdump 
core_dump_dest=/u01/app/oracle/admin/logdb/cdump
user_dump_dest=/u01/app/oracle/admin/logdb/udump  


5.连接到instance
$ sqlplus /nolog
SQL> CONNECT SYS AS SYSDBA


6.创建服务器参数文件(spfile)
CREATE SPFILE FROM PFILE;


7.启动instance
STARTUP NOMOUNT;


8.执行创建数据库命令
CREATE DATABASE logdb
   USER SYS IDENTIFIED BY sys_password
   USER SYSTEM IDENTIFIED BY system_password
   LOGFILE GROUP 1 ('/u01/logs/my/redo01a.log','/u02/logs/my/redo01b.log') SIZE 100M BLOCKSIZE 512,
           GROUP 2 ('/u01/logs/my/redo02a.log','/u02/logs/my/redo02b.log') SIZE 100M BLOCKSIZE 512,
           GROUP 3 ('/u01/logs/my/redo03a.log','/u02/logs/my/redo03b.log') SIZE 100M BLOCKSIZE 512
   MAXLOGFILES 5
   MAXLOGMEMBERS 5
   MAXLOGHISTORY 1
   MAXDATAFILES 100
   CHARACTER SET ZHS16GBK
   NATIONAL CHARACTER SET  AL16UTF16
   EXTENT MANAGEMENT LOCAL
   DATAFILE '+DATA2/logdb/system01.dbf' SIZE 325M REUSE
   SYSAUX DATAFILE '+DATA/logdb/sysaux01.dbf' SIZE 325M REUSE
   DEFAULT TABLESPACE users
      DATAFILE '+DATA2/logdb/users01.dbf'
      SIZE 500M REUSE AUTOEXTEND ON MAXSIZE UNLIMITED
   DEFAULT TEMPORARY TABLESPACE tempts1
      TEMPFILE '+DATA2/logdb/temp01.dbf'
      SIZE 20M REUSE
   UNDO TABLESPACE undotbs
      DATAFILE '+DATA2/logdb/undotbs01.dbf'
      SIZE 200M REUSE AUTOEXTEND ON MAXSIZE UNLIMITED;









阅读(2144) | 评论(0) | 转发(0) |
给主人留下些什么吧!~~